Subject: Cut-over done — pooling changes live

Hey plugin folks,

The Brindlewick cut-over wrapped up last night. We moved QuillBase to the new connection pooler, so long-lived connections from plugins will now get recycled every few minutes. Most of you won't notice anything, but please retest reconnect logic. The current pooling settings are listed below.

service settings:
[casax]
port = 6379
team = rusir
host = casax.zemvarhq.corp
region = outer-4
access_code = ac_9808ce
timeout_ms = 1500

- [ ] **Step 7: Breaker override escrow.** After sealing the signing keys for the Tallgrove upstream API circuit breaker, confirm the support team can force the breaker open during a full outage. The override bundle lives in the sealed escrow drawer and is useless without its unlock phrase. Two ceremony witnesses must initial this step before proceeding. The escrow bundle is decrypted with the recovery passphrase that follows.

vault phrase of kahip-kahop = holath-quenmir

**14:22 — Leak confirmed in Tidewren image cache**

Ok, so this is where it got fun: eviction callbacks on the Tidewren thumbnail cache were never firing, so decoded bitmaps just piled up until the renderer tipped over. Heap dumps made it obvious once we looked. First bad build is stamped below.

session token of bagep-haduf = htk4_fac0

Subject: Master copies pickup — Penrow Printers

Dispatch — the master copies for the Ashgrove brochure job are staged at bay 3, one sealed tube plus a folder. Penrow Printers needs them before their 15:00 plate run. Priority van, direct route, no consolidation. Shift lead signs them out personally. The courier hand-over instruction follows below.

dispatch memo: the lamwyn fenwyn courier leaves the wenir ledger at gate 7175 under passcode 822969

# Break-Glass: Gaugelet Sidecar

If the Gaugelet metrics-aggregation sidecar wedges and normal deploy creds are unavailable, break-glass is your friend. Page the duty officer first — this gets audited. The sealed access kit lets you restart Gaugelet across the Marrowfield fleet and flush its buffer without touching the host pods. The kit unlocks with the recovery passphrase below.

unlock words, tawif-tahop: oliys-ulawyn-tamdor-lamys-casox-jormir-fraius-kasath-ulador-ulamir-holir-sorys-holeth